Course Description

Individuals, groups, and corporate or organizational decision making. Emphasis on analysis of decision making in natural resource contexts: decision factors, cognitions, and processes. Decision-making philosophies and strategies; the roles of personal and professional ethics in decision-making; factors in natural resources decisions and their impacts.
